China Mobile's Nanjing Branch Overcharges Users

2009-03-30 by ChinaWirelessNews.com Editor | Print | Email Email

The Nanjing branch of China Mobile has reportedly been involved in illegal charges of up to CNY30 million.

According to local Chinese media, a national special audit of telecom costs arranged by the National Development and Reform Commission identified China Mobile's Nanjing branch as having overcharged consumers about CNY30 million between January 2007 and August 2008.

At the same time, an unnamed representative from China Mobile Nanjing has confirmed that they had been audited, but the person has said that they have not had any idea of the check results. There is no word yet how or if Chinese consumers will gain rebates.

China Mobile's 2008 annual report shows that the company's net profit in the year reached CNY112.8 billion, which ranks it top among all China's state-owned companies.
